It has been a very busy start to the new academic year at Queen's Crescent School.

Their 60 new Foundation Stage children have settled well into their new classrooms and are enjoying using the new outdoor play equipment that was installed over the summer holidays.

12 of the Year 6 children have already taken part and completed their Bikeability training.

The school has held a 'Ready, Steady, Cook' event organised by Chartwells, their caterers, which saw 2 members of staff and their teams creating two meals that were then voted on by the Year 4, 5, 6 children watching.  The Red team were the winners with their amazing Thai curry!  A great time was had by all!

Queen's Crescent School has also held a whole school sponsored fun run in order to raise funds to further equip their two new classrooms.  The children had a fantastic time and were amazing runners - the school is now waiting for the sponsorship money to be collected in to see how much has been raised.  A prize will be awarded to the most successful fundraiser.

24 new school councillors have been elected, 2 for each class from Y1-Y6.
